Object-oriented data storage and retrieval system using...

Data processing: database and file management or data structures – Database design – Data structure types

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C707S793000, C707S793000, C707S793000, C707S793000, C707S793000

Reexamination Certificate

active

06539388

ABSTRACT:

BACKGROUND OF THE INVENTION
The present invention relates to a data storage and retrieval system for retrieving data distributed and stored on a network and presenting the retrieved data by a user-desired presentation form.
This application is based on Japanese Patent Application No. 9-289770, filed Oct. 22, 1997 and Japanese Patent Application No. 9-307460, filed Nov. 10, 1997, the contents of which are incorporated herein by reference.
Generally, data is based on a personal intention and interpretation. Because of the personal preference, data to be provided is constructed from the viewpoint based on the data provider. The provider constructs data to maximize the utility function of the provider and provides the data. A user to which the data is provided also has a utility function and a demand for referring to and processing the data to maximize the utility function of the user.
The architecture of a recent database system is modeled as a three-layer schema. An external schema layer is closest to the application layer of the three-layer schema. This layer provides a specific method (view or presentation form) of viewing a data structure as part of a database to a specific user (or group). Such a database system places prominence to prevent a physical or logical change in the data structure from influencing on the application software rather than to reconstruct the retrieved data in accordance with the viewpoint of the user.
In the conventional framework of database, an end user is not allowed to freely manipulate the view for the database, and no mechanism is available to allow a plurality of users to share view for the database. That is, only viewing based on the database developer/manager is pre sent. The view is associated with not data expression or data behavior but the data structure. As described above, with the conventional view for the database, the data can hardly be reconstructed in accordance with the viewpoint of the user in the true sense.
BRIEF SUMMARY OF THE INVENTION
It is an object of the present invention to provide a data storage and retrieval system which allows a user to freely change the data presentation form from his/her viewpoint to widen the data utilization and promotes data utilization, and a recording medium recording a computer program for data storage and retrieval.
According t o an aspect of the present invention, there is provided a data storage and retrieval system comprising storage means for storing data belonging to a predetermined category and definition data which is made to correspond to the data in advance and describes definitions of a data structure and presentation form, retrieval means for retrieving the data and the definition data made to correspond to the data in advance from the storage means on the basis of input retrieval data, rewrite means for rewriting, based on another definition data stored in the storage means, the definition data made to correspond in advance to data retrieved by the retrieval means and presentation means for presenting, based on the definition data rewritten by the rewrite means, the data retrieved by the retrieval means.
This arrangement allows not only to simply retrieve and present a data space but also to easily display the data in a display form desired by a user by rewriting the definition data of the retrieved data using another definition data.
According to another aspect of the present invention, there is provided a data storage and retrieval system comprising storage means for storing data belonging to a predetermined category and definition data describing definitions of a structure and presentation form of the data, retrieval means for retrieving presentable data from the storage means on the basis of designated definition data, and presentation means for presenting, based on the designated definition data, the data retrieved by the retrieval means.
This arrangement allows not only to simply retrieve and present a data space but also to retrieve and present data matching a presentation form desired by a user.
Additional objects, and advantages of the present invention will be set forth in the description which follows, and in part will be obvious from the description, or may be learned by practice of the present invention.
The objects and advantages of the present invention may be realized and obtained by means of the instrumentalities and combinations particularly pointed out hereinafter.


REFERENCES:
patent: 5448726 (1995-09-01), Cramsie et al.
patent: 5649190 (1997-07-01), Sharif-Askary et al.
patent: 5666524 (1997-09-01), Kunkel et al.
patent: 5680614 (1997-10-01), Bakuya et al.
patent: 5724575 (1998-03-01), Hoover et al.
patent: 5857197 (1999-01-01), Mullins
patent: 5983216 (1999-11-01), Kirsch et al.
patent: 6006214 (1999-12-01), Carey et al.
patent: 6122627 (2000-09-01), Carey et al.
patent: 6134540 (2000-10-01), Carey et al.
patent: 63-273947 (1988-11-01), None
IBM TDB (“Access Path Selection in Relational Database Systems”, Feb. 1988, vol. 30, pp. 420-421).*
Robert Oralfi, et al., The Essential Distributed Objects Survival Guide, Chapter 16, pps. 283-295, Chapter 20, pps 343-355, 1996.
Serge Abiteboul, et al., SIGMOD Record, vol. 20, No. 2, pps. 1-24 and Appendix pps. i-iv, “Objects And Views”, Dec. 30, 1993.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Object-oriented data storage and retrieval system using...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Object-oriented data storage and retrieval system using..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Object-oriented data storage and retrieval system using...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-3042263

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.